Street Grind Skate Shop

1 stores
Store name:
Street Grind Skate Shop
Store locator


List of Street Grind Skate Shop stores

Street Grind Skate Shop in Valle Vista Mall (Texas)

2020 S. Expressway 83, Harlingen, TX 78552




Information about Street Grind Skate Shop



Street Grind Skate Shop store locations

Keywords: Street Grind Skate Shop,store, factory, sale